Skip to content

Commit 60947f5

Browse files
authored
Merge pull request #1 from aarron-lee/main
add suspend workaround
2 parents d203233 + 26b2649 commit 60947f5

File tree

2 files changed

+25
-1
lines changed

2 files changed

+25
-1
lines changed

README.md

Lines changed: 6 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-54,11 +54,16 @@ followed by
5454
### [Where to find ChimeraOS for your Legion Go](https://chimeraos.org/download/)
5555
Please see the installation section of the ChimeraOS website, just remember to install the unstable branch as mentioned earlier in this guide.
5656

57+
### [Device immediately waking up from suspend](guides/suspend_workaround.md)
58+
59+
Some users are reporting that suspend/resume is not working, try the workaround [here](guides/suspend_workaround.md)
60+
5761
### [How to install Handycon - Controller Workaround w/ Steam/QAM (OLD)](https://github.com/bactaholic/chimeraos-legion-go-tricks/blob/main/guides/controller_workaround_handycon.md)
5862
THIS SHOULD ALREADY COME PREINSTALLED WITH CHIMERAOS IF YOU INSTALLED THE UNSTABLE BRANCH. Handycon has been updated to support the Legion Go and brings controller functionality in addition to Steam/QAM menus using the Legion Buttons and how to change combos.
5963

6064
### [How to remap Steam/QAM Buttons to Scrollwheel (OLD)](https://github.com/bactaholic/chimeraos-legion-go-tricks/blob/main/guides/controller_workaround_input_mapper.md)
6165
If for whatever reason other guides to guide the Steam/QAM Buttons working don't work for you, you can use this workaround. Please note, this is not a permanent solution, as the guide explains.
6266

67+
6368
### [Using EasyEffects to Improve Speaker Audio Quality](https://github.com/bactaholic/chimeraos-legion-go-tricks/tree/main)
64-
WIP!! AWAITING GUIDE
69+
WIP!! AWAITING GUIDE

guides/suspend_workaround.md

Lines changed: 19 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,19 @@
1+
## Legion Go immediately waking up from suspend
2+
3+
Some users are reporting that suspend/resume is not working.
4+
5+
The Legion Go controllers are waking up the device.
6+
7+
For to workaround this issue, create a udev rule that blocks the controllers from waking the device.
8+
9+
You can install the fix by running the following in terminal, then reboot:
10+
11+
```
12+
echo 'ACTION=="add", SUBSYSTEM=="pci", DEVPATH=="*/0000:00:08.1/*c2:00.3", ATTR{power/wakeup}="disabled"' | sudo tee /etc/udev/rules.d/99-suspend-fix.rules
13+
```
14+
15+
If you wish to remove this fix later on, simply delete the udev rule file.
16+
17+
```
18+
sudo rm /etc/udev/rules.d/99-suspend-fix.rules
19+
```

0 commit comments

Comments
 (0)